The company’s latest developments highlight its ability to transform urban landscapes while maintaining strong financial growth. One of Nextensa’s most significant accomplishments is the continued development of the Tour & Taxis site in Brussels.
This mixed-use project is designed to integrate office spaces, residential units, and retail areas within a single, well-connected environment. Tour & Taxis has attracted major tenants due to its modern design and strategic location.
By offering a blend of work, leisure, and living spaces, the project aims to create a vibrant urban hub. Nextensa’s focus on multi-use developments reflects its strategy to enhance urban centers with diverse, well-planned properties.
A key milestone for Nextensa is the agreement with Proximus, a major telecommunications company, to establish its headquarters at the Tour & Taxis site. Proximus will occupy 37,000 square meters, reinforcing the project’s appeal to leading corporations.
The company expects the lease agreement to be finalized in early 2025, further strengthening its position in the commercial real estate market. The presence of a major corporate tenant adds credibility to the development and increases its long-term value.
This partnership also highlights the attractiveness of Nextensa’s projects to businesses looking for high-quality office spaces. Beyond Brussels, Nextensa is expanding its portfolio with the acquisition of The Bel Towers near Brussels North railway station.
This project involves transforming the iconic Proximus towers into a mixed-use destination, maximizing reuse and modernizing the structures for contemporary needs. The redevelopment will include office spaces, commercial areas, and residential units, making it a key addition to Nextensa’s portfolio. This acquisition aligns with the company’s strategy of revitalizing existing properties while ensuring long-term profitability.
The redevelopment of The Bel Towers is expected to enhance the area’s appeal and increase property values. Nextensa’s investment portfolio is well-diversified across key markets, with holdings in Luxembourg, Belgium, and Austria. Luxembourg accounts for 43% of the portfolio, Belgium 42%, and Austria 15%, totaling approximately €1.2 billion in asset value.
The company actively manages and optimizes its portfolio by balancing acquisitions, developments, and divestments. This strategic approach allows it to maintain strong financial performance while expanding into new growth areas. The ability to adjust its portfolio based on market conditions ensures stability and continued profitability.
The company’s financial results reflect its success in executing its strategy. Nextensa’s rental income increased by €1.7 million compared to the previous year, representing 4.7% growth despite the sale of multiple properties.
These divestments, including a retail park in Zaventem and a retail building in Foetz, generated a profit of €3.5 million. The ability to sell assets at a profit while continuing to grow rental income demonstrates the effectiveness of Nextensa’s asset management.
